Claims
- 1. An apparatus for purifying boron trichloride by removal of phosgene, said apparatus comprising:
- a reactor comprising a vessel having a head space, an inlet to receive said boron trichloride beneath said head space, an outlet to discharge an overhead stream comprising carbon monoxide and chlorine and means for providing at least one source of electromagnetic radiation having a wavelength in a range of between about 230 and about 254 nanometers to decompose said phosgene and to produce said carbon monoxide and chlorine as vapor and liquid phases in equilibrium with one another and in solution with said boron trichloride; and
- means located in a bottom region of said vessel for producing a vapor stream rising through said boron trichloride and composed of a substance to disturb said equilibrium and to cause said carbon monoxide to be carried out of solution and collect in said head space.
- 2. The apparatus of claim 1, wherein said vapor stream producing means is a sparging nozzle located within said bottom region of said vessel.
- 3. The apparatus of claim 1, further comprising a head condenser in communication with said head space to condense any boron trichloride vapor.
- 4. The apparatus of claim 1, wherein said at least one source of electromagnetic radiation comprises a mercury vapor lamp.
- 5. The apparatus of claim 1, wherein said wavelength is about 254 nanometers.
- 6. The apparatus of claim 2, further comprising a head condenser in communication with said head space to condense any boron trichloride vapor.
- 7. The apparatus of claim 6, wherein said at least one source of electromagnetic radiation comprises a tube mercury vapor lamp.
- 8. The apparatus of claim 7, wherein said wavelength is about 254 nanometers.
